**Mgmt Meeting Minutes — Retiring the Brightline Range**

Quick recap for sales leads at Fenholt Supplies: we agreed to retire the Brightline fixture range by year-end. Remaining stock moves to clearance pricing next month, and accounts on standing orders get migrated to the Lumetta range. Trade-in incentives were approved in principle. The confidential note on next steps sits just below.

board note of bajof-bajeg: The pricing group signed off on a budget of $13.4 million for Project Sildor. The renewal with Lamixek Holdings closes at $48.9 million a year, 49 percent above the last contract.

### WebSocket compression on Larkfeed

Quick context before you review: we enable permessage-deflate only for payloads over 2 KB, since compressing tiny heartbeat frames burned more CPU than it saved bandwidth. Context takeover is disabled to cap memory per connection. Gateway builds that change these settings must be re-signed, and the deploy key for that pipeline is included below.

signing key of yahop-kajeg = bky19_kGEQSkL2VKL1WQYJhcX

## Service Accounts — Matchwright Pairing Service

GC pauses in the pairing loop exceed 400ms under load, so the `svc-matchwright-gc` account now runs the heap profiler on a 10-minute cadence. Reviewers: check that retries on `POST /pairs` are idempotent before approving changes, since pauses can double-fire callbacks. The profiler writes to the Telemetry Vault bucket and authenticates via the shared internal key. Use the key below for local verification.

API key for yahig-tadup: kto7_ubizbYm

Runbook fragment — account recovery, Tindra Search. Slow autocomplete traced to an unpartitioned prefix index; rebuilt with shard-local tries, p95 now 40ms. No auth paths touched; recovery flow unchanged except faster username suggestions. Security note: recovery tokens remain single-use, 10-minute TTL. To open the recovery keystore on the admin bastion during verification, enter the passphrase shown below.

recovery phrase for bawef-kagug: casix-tamvan-lamath-holeth-gilmir-drudor-julax-wenok-wenael-rusvan-holax-goriel-frawyn